What’s the role? As an Analyst, GTS Client Services, you will provide high‑quality sales and service support to a portfolio of institutional and corporate clients across the customer lifecycle. You’ll act as a trusted point of contact, ensuring service excellence, proactive engagement, and effective risk management while supporting revenue and deposit growth. This role will work closely with Relationship Managers and broader GTS and WIB teams to deliver seamless client outcomes. You’ll manage service delivery for your client portfolio, act as the primary escalation point, resolve enquiries within agreed SLAs, and deliver proactive service while supporting revenue growth, strong risk and documentation compliance, and continuous improvement. What do I need? Proven experience servicing institutional or corporate clients, ideally across transactional banking, lending, or financial markets Strong understanding of client servicing models, products, systems, and operational processes Demonstrated ability to manage client relationships and deliver consistently high service outcomes Sound business and commercial acumen, with the ability to identify client needs and opportunities Strong stakeholder engagement skills, with experience working across multiple internal teams A proactive, solutions‑focused mindset with a strong focus on risk, accuracy, and compliance Why join us?
